To calculate the acceleration (a), we can use the formula:
a = (V - V0) / t1
a = (16 m/s - 20 m/s) / 2 s
a = (-4 m/s) / 2 s
a = -2 m/s^2
Therefore, the acceleration is -2 m/s^2.
